  <dc:title>Watch-house charge book</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Diary entry format recording incidents reported on the watch, including fires, robbery, drunk and disorderly behaviour, grave robbing including 'resurrectionists' [body snatchers who were commonly employed by anatomists] at Poplar Chapel churchyard.
Watchmen were responsible for maintaining order and security in the parish, before the police service was formed.</dc:description>
  <dc:date>1822-1828</dc:date>
